1. Hong Kong Disneyland – A Magical Adventure for All Ages

No family trip to Hong Kong is complete without a visit to Hong Kong Disneyland.  Many people dream of going to Disneyland in Hong Kong. Kids and parents can enjoy thrilling rides, parades, and character meet-and-greets with various types of themed lands like Fantasyland, Adventureland, and Tomorrowland. The iconic Sleeping Beauty Castle creates the perfect backdrop for memorable photos.

2. Ocean Park – Marine Wonders and Thrilling Rides

Ocean Park combines marine life exhibits, thrilling rides, and entertaining shows. Families can explore the Grand Aquarium, watch playful dolphins and sea lions, or ride the Hair Raiser roller coaster for adrenaline. The park’s cable car ride offers stunning coastline views, making the journey between attractions as exciting as the destinations. It is known as a perfect place to visit for education and excitement, ensuring kids have fun while learning about marine conservation.

3. Ngong Ping 360 – A Scenic Cable Car Experience

For families looking to mix adventure with culture, Ngong Ping 360 is a must-visit. The cable car ride provides panoramic views of Lantau Island, the South China Sea, and the famous Tian Tan Buddha statue. After reaching Ngong Ping Village, families can explore traditional shops, try local delicacies or local food, and take in the peaceful atmosphere of Po Lin Monastery. With breathtaking sights and a touch of cultural exploration, this famous attraction perfectly balances excitement and relaxation.

4. Hong Kong Science Museum – Interactive Learning for Curious Minds

This museum is a paradise for young people who love hands-on learning. With over 500 exhibits, children can engage with interactive displays covering robotics, space, and physics. One of the highlights is the Energy Machine, a massive device that creates a mesmerizing chain reaction of moving balls and sounds. Science lovers of all ages will find this museum both educational and entertaining, making it an excellent indoor option for families visiting on a rainy day.

5. Victoria Peak – A Breathtaking View of the City

Victoria Peak is the best place to get the best views of Hong Kong’s skyline. Families can take the historic Peak Tram to the top and enjoy a bird’s-eye view of the city’s skyscrapers, Victoria Harbour, and surrounding islands. The Peak Tower offers observation decks, restaurants, and various family-friendly attractions like Madame Tussauds Wax Museum. The panoramic scenery will leave everyone in awe, whether visiting during the day or at night.

6. Hong Kong Park – A Green Escape in the City

Amidst the bustling streets, Hong Kong Park provides a refreshing retreat with lush gardens, waterfalls, and playgrounds. Kids can run around in the large aviary, which houses exotic birds in a rainforest-like setting. The park also comprises a peaceful pond filled with turtles and koi fish, which makes it an ideal relaxing spot. It’s a wonderful place to slow down, breathe fresh air, and break from the fast-paced city life.

7. Stanley Market and Beach – A Relaxed Shopping and Seaside Experience

Stanley Market is the perfect destination for families who love shopping and the beach. This open-air market offers a variety of souvenirs, clothes, and local crafts. After browsing the stalls, families can unwind at Stanley Beach, where kids can build sandcastles and splash in the waves. The area also has a selection of restaurants overlooking the sea, making it a fantastic place to enjoy a family meal with a view.

8. Big Buddha and Po Lin Monastery – A Cultural Experience

One of Hong Kong’s most famous landmarks, the Big Buddha, is an awe-inspiring sight. Families can climb the 268 steps leading up to the statue for a closer look at its impressive details. Nearby, Po Lin Monastery offers a peaceful escape, with beautiful gardens and traditional Chinese architecture. This attraction provides a great way for kids to learn about Hong Kong’s cultural and spiritual heritage while enjoying a scenic adventure.

9. Tai O Fishing Village – A Glimpse Into Traditional Hong Kong Life

For a more authentic experience, families can visit Tai O, a historic fishing village known for its stilt houses and seafood markets. A boat ride through the waterways offers a chance to spot rare pink dolphins, making it a favorite for nature lovers. The village is also great for trying local snacks and seeing how traditional salted fish is made. It’s a unique way to step back and experience a different side of Hong Kong.

10. Kowloon Walled City Park – A Journey Through History

Once a densely populated settlement, Kowloon Walled City has been transformed into a beautiful park filled with historical remnants and Chinese-style gardens. Families can walk through the preserved South Gate, explore ancient stone pathways, and learn about the city’s fascinating past. The peaceful surroundings make it an excellent spot for a stroll, contrasting the high-energy attractions in other parts of Hong Kong.
